Output 86efc3fb151d7150394d7b096010206deb3925248de08d3a90075b5e8f48b840:1

value
506608
script pubkey
OP_0 OP_PUSHBYTES_20 9f6bb2af1492a8def507f0fd72abb7fac880b966
address
ltc1qna4m9tc5j25daag87r7h92ahltygpwtxgcfkye
transaction
86efc3fb151d7150394d7b096010206deb3925248de08d3a90075b5e8f48b840
spent
true